<div dir="ltr"><span style="font-family: courier new,monospace;">Hubert,</span><br style="font-family: courier new,monospace;"><br style="font-family: courier new,monospace;"><span style="font-family: courier new,monospace;">Tenho boa experiência com Perl sobre Windows e acho que posso ajudar, mas eu preciso entender algumas coisas antes:</span><br style="font-family: courier new,monospace;">
<span style="font-family: courier new,monospace;">* Qual distro de Perl vc está utilizando ?</span><br style="font-family: courier new,monospace;"><span style="font-family: courier new,monospace;">* Como você instalou os módulos ?</span><br>
<br><br><div class="gmail_quote">2008/9/15 Hubert Thomaz Neto <span dir="ltr">&lt;<a href="mailto:hubert.thomaz@gvt.com.br">hubert.thomaz@gvt.com.br</a>&gt;</span><br><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">











<div link="blue" vlink="purple" lang="PT-BR">

<div><div class="Ih2E3d">

<div>

<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;">P</span></font><font color="black"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: black;">rezados,</span></font></p>


</div>

<div>

<p><font face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ial;">não sei se esta é a forma correta de obter ajuda/suporte
sobre o Perl, mas agradeço se puderem me auxiliar com&nbsp;a dificuldade que
estou enfrentando para executar um script Perl em um servidor Win2000 Server.</span></font></p>

</div>

<div>

<p><font face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ial;"><br>Tenho um script que&nbsp;roda num Desktop e está executando
perfeitamente. Instalamos o Perl em um Servidor MS Win2000 Server no drive D:\PERL.
Mudamos no script a linha que indica do drive C:\PERL para D:\PERL.</span></font></p>

</div>

<div>



</div>



</div><div>

<p><font face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ial;">Quando executa no entanto está indicando um erro<font color="navy"><span style="color: navy;">: " Can&#39;t locate Class/Date.pm in
@INC ..."</span></font></span></font></p>



<p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;"></span></font></p></div></div></div></blockquote><div style="font-family: courier new,monospace;">Então, normalmente esta mensagem está relacionado ao fato de que o módulo não está acessível. Eu não entendi o que você quis dizer com &#39;<font size="2"><span style="font-size: 10pt;">Mudamos no script a linha que indica do drive C:\PERL para D:\PERL.&#39;. O teu script utiliza o caminho do diretório do Perl ? Você pode postar este pedaço do código ? Pq a principio não faz muito sentido isto, pois para carregar um código é só utilizar o &#39;use Class::Date;&#39;<br>
</span></font></div><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"><div link="blue" vlink="purple" lang="PT-BR"><div><div><p><font color="navy" face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ial; color: navy;">parece</span></font><font face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ial;"> que não encontra a
CLASS::<a href="http://DATE.PM" target="_blank">DATE.PM</a>. A questão é que a biblioteca est<font color="navy"><span style="color: navy;">á</span></font> na pasta embaixo de D:\PERL. Será que é
necessário adicionar um PATH na máquina para encontrar o arquivo?</span></font></p>

</div><div class="Ih2E3d">



<div>

<p><font face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ial;">Li algo sobre instalar a Class-Date? Preciso fazer isso?</span></font></p></div></div></div></div></blockquote><div><span style="font-family: courier new,monospace;">Cara vai depender da distro de perl que vc está utilizando. Para Windows eu recomendo o Active Perl (</span><cite><span style="font-family: courier new,monospace;"><a href="http://www.activestate.com/store/download.aspx?prdGUID=81fbce82-6bd5-49bc-a915-08d58c2648ca">http://www.activestate.com/store/download.aspx?prdGUID=81fbce82-6bd5-49bc-a915-08d58c2648ca</a>).</span><br style="font-family: courier new,monospace;">
<br></cite></div><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"><div link="blue" vlink="purple" lang="PT-BR"><div><div class="Ih2E3d"><div>
<p><font face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ial;"></span></font></p>

</div>



<div>

<p><font face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ial;">Agradeço pelas dicas, ou sugestão onde posso encontrar a
solução para este problema.</span></font></p></div></div></div></div></blockquote><div><span style="font-family: courier new,monospace;">Alternativas :</span><br style="font-family: courier new,monospace;"><span style="font-family: courier new,monospace;">* tenho um script e preciso distribui, como posso fazer ? Utilize o PAR para fazer a distribuição dos scripts sem precisar &#39;instalar&#39; o perl nos servidores, o tempo de load é maior mas para o mundo MS dá um sensação de facilidade.<br>
* Não tenho problema de instalar no servidor windows, que disto utilizar ? Eu recomendo o Active Perl (ele é free, o valor no site é para outros produtos), pois ele tem uma boa quantidade de módulos já compilado e de fácil instalação.<br>
* A quero entender o quê está ocorrendo exatamente. Eu recomendo fortemente as ferramentas do SysInternals (www.sysinternals). Lá tem um monte de ferramentas que qualquer sysadmin de Windows deveria conhecer de olhos fechados. Dê uma olhada no FileMon que ele vai lhe informar em qual diretório o teu script está tentando pegar o módulo.<br>
<br></span></div><blockquote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"><div link="blue" vlink="purple" lang="PT-BR"><div><div class="Ih2E3d"><div>
<p><font face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ial;"></span></font></p>

</div>

<div>

<p><font face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ial;">Grato,</span></font></p>

</div>

<div>

<p><font face="Arial" size="2"><span style="font-size: 10pt; font-family: Arial;">Hubert</span></font></p>

</div>_______________________________________________<br></div></div>

</div>
SaoPaulo-pm mailing list<br>
<a href="mailto:SaoPaulo-pm@pm.org">SaoPaulo-pm@pm.org</a><br>
<a href="http://mail.pm.org/mailman/listinfo/saopaulo-pm" target="_blank">http://mail.pm.org/mailman/listinfo/saopaulo-pm</a><br></blockquote></div><br><br clear="all"><br>-- <br>&quot;o animal satisfeito dorme&quot;. - Guimarães Rosa<br>

</div>